Patchouli

Pogostemon cablin

Cultivated in Indonesia, Philippines, Malaysia, China, India and Mauritius. Traditionally used as incense, insect repellent and to treat colds, headaches, nausea, vomiting, diarrhoea and abdominal pain. Pharmacological known for its anti-microbial activities for skin conditions, it also has a profound effect on the nervous system and a valuable component for skincare preparations.

Scent - Base note

Sweet herbaceous, earthiness-musty- distilled from the leaves.

SAFETY GUIDELINES 

General regarded as safe. Perform patch and/or scent test before use. For any skin allergic reactions, run tap water or cool compress on affected areas until redness subsided. Store essential oil in a dark, cool and dry place and avoid sunlight and keep children out of reach.

Essential oils are not safe to apply on the skin undiluted nor to consume any small amounts which can cause significant poisoning.
